What happened
Switzerland faces significant injury doubts ahead of their 2026 World Cup round of 16 match against Colombia in Vancouver. Colombia, missing John Córdoba, remains the favorite and aims to advance to the quarterfinals. Switzerland’s coach Murat Yakin is concerned about three injured key players but insists any starters will be fully fit.
- 01Switzerland faces major injury concerns before their World Cup round of 16 match against Colombia.
- 02Colombia’s John Córdoba is out with a muscle tear, replaced by Luis Suárez.
- 03Colombia is the only team to have played in all three host countries in the 2026 World Cup.
- 04Switzerland has not reached a World Cup quarterfinal since 1954 and seeks to break this streak.
- 05Coach Murat Yakin says injured Swiss players must be 100% fit to play or will be replaced.
- 06The match will decide who faces Argentina or Egypt in the quarterfinals.
